Transaction 75c31bc92886a060f905ea8e4941caf6a4da873e5ecac5cb13e25a1811e1142b

4 Input
2 Outputs
  • 75c31bc92886a060f905ea8e4941caf6a4da873e5ecac5cb13e25a1811e1142b:0
  • value  165700000
    address  15qUAY1Ck8GkVR3Tva69nzpWsLphDj8WHD
  • 75c31bc92886a060f905ea8e4941caf6a4da873e5ecac5cb13e25a1811e1142b:1
  • value  60779915
    address  1FYZwy7iiDhVBkrAdL6cjyrsK651gQFox1